	<description>HTML5 can be used in Windows Phone application development. Leveraging HTML5 allows publishing a same application on several platforms reusing a maximum of code. Tools and frameworks such as Apache Cordova (previously known as PhoneGap) allow to &amp;quot;wrap&amp;quot; the HTML5 and JavaScript code into a native application using the WebBrowser control. In this video you can watch a rapid demo of the following: Integration of the HTML5 code into an Apache Cordova solution within Visual Studio to generate a Windows Phone application The jQueryMobile theme for Windows Phone (Metro style) is applied to better integrate the application into the Windows Phone experience </description>
